Changing Information Technology Inc. MOTP(Mobile One Time Password) - SQL Injection

Vulnerability Description

Changing MOTP (Mobile One Time Password) system’s specific function parameter has insufficient validation for user input. A attacker in local area network can perform SQL injection attack to read, modify or delete backend database without authentication.
